腾讯云Linux镜像选择指南:推荐CentOS与Ubuntu
结论先行
对于腾讯云Linux镜像的选择,推荐优先考虑CentOS或Ubuntu,具体取决于您的业务需求和技术栈。CentOS适合企业级稳定环境,Ubuntu则更适合开发者和前沿技术支持。
镜像选择的核心因素
选择Linux镜像时需重点考虑以下因素:
- 稳定性:生产环境优先选择长期支持版本(LTS)
- 社区与生态:活跃的社区和软件包支持
- 腾讯云优化:官方提供的优化镜像性能更好
- 安全更新:及时的漏洞修复和补丁支持
主流镜像对比分析
1. CentOS系列
- 推荐版本:CentOS 7/8(注:CentOS 8已停止维护,建议迁移至替代方案)
- 优势:
- 企业级稳定性,Red Hat兼容
- 腾讯云提供优化版镜像
- 适合传统服务器、数据库等关键业务
- 劣势:
- CentOS 8已终止支持,需考虑替代方案(如Rocky Linux/AlmaLinux)
- 软件包版本较保守
适用场景:X_X、ERP等需要长期稳定的企业应用。
2. Ubuntu Server
- 推荐版本:Ubuntu 20.04/22.04 LTS
- 优势:
- 每2年发布LTS版本,支持周期长达5年
- 软件包更新快,开发者生态丰富
- 腾讯云提供内核优化版
- 劣势:
- 非LTS版本不适合生产环境
适用场景:云计算、容器化(如K8s)、AI开发等前沿技术。
3. TencentOS Server
- 腾讯自研镜像,基于CentOS优化
- 优势:
- 深度适配腾讯云硬件(如网络、存储)
- 默认集成云监控、安全组件
- 劣势:
- 社区生态弱于主流发行版
适用场景:需要深度云集成的业务,如大规模集群部署。
4. 其他可选镜像
- Debian:稳定性极佳,但国内生态较弱
- OpenSUSE:适合特定企业需求
- AlmaLinux/Rocky Linux:CentOS替代方案,需自行评估兼容性
关键建议
- 优先选择LTS版本,避免使用非长期支持版。
- 腾讯云优化镜像 > 原生镜像,性能和安全更有保障。
- 新业务建议Ubuntu,老业务可延续CentOS生态(迁移时考虑Rocky Linux)。
操作步骤示例(腾讯云控制台)
- 进入云服务器购买页,在“镜像”中选择“公共镜像”
- 筛选Linux类型(如CentOS 7.6/Ubuntu 22.04)
- 勾选“腾讯云优化”选项(如有)
- 注意选择64位系统(ARM/x86根据机型决定)
总结
对于大多数用户,Ubuntu LTS是最平衡的选择;若需Red Hat兼容性,则选用CentOS替代发行版(如Rocky Linux)。 腾讯云优化镜像能进一步提升性能,建议优先采用。
CLOUD云计算